public static final class SrvMonAdminClientStats.Pojo extends Object implements UtlPool.Item<SrvMonAdminClientStats.Pojo>
public static final SrvMonAdminClientStats.Pojo create(boolean pvt)
public static final SrvMonAdminClientStats.Pojo create()
public final boolean hasLifecyclesSent()
public final long getLifecyclesSent()
public final void setLifecyclesSent(long val)
public final void clearLifecyclesSent()
public final boolean hasHeartbeatsSent()
public final long getHeartbeatsSent()
public final void setHeartbeatsSent(long val)
public final void clearHeartbeatsSent()
public final boolean hasHeartbeatsDropped()
public final long getHeartbeatsDropped()
public final void setHeartbeatsDropped(long val)
public final void clearHeartbeatsDropped()
public final boolean hasTracesSent()
public final long getTracesSent()
public final void setTracesSent(long val)
public final void clearTracesSent()
public final boolean hasTracesDropped()
public final long getTracesDropped()
public final void setTracesDropped(long val)
public final void clearTracesDropped()
public final boolean hasOutboundQueueCapacity()
public final int getOutboundQueueCapacity()
public final void setOutboundQueueCapacity(int val)
public final void clearOutboundQueueCapacity()
public final boolean hasOutboundQueueSize()
public final int getOutboundQueueSize()
public final void setOutboundQueueSize(int val)
public final void clearOutboundQueueSize()
public final boolean hasOutboundQueueCount()
public final int getOutboundQueueCount()
public final void setOutboundQueueCount(int val)
public final void clearOutboundQueueCount()
public final boolean hasOutboundQueueFlushSize()
public final long getOutboundQueueFlushSize()
public final void setOutboundQueueFlushSize(long val)
public final void clearOutboundQueueFlushSize()
public final boolean hasOutboundQueueFlushCount()
public final long getOutboundQueueFlushCount()
public final void setOutboundQueueFlushCount(long val)
public final void clearOutboundQueueFlushCount()
public final boolean hasFlushesScheduled()
public final long getFlushesScheduled()
public final void setFlushesScheduled(long val)
public final void clearFlushesScheduled()
public final boolean hasFlushesExecuted()
public final long getFlushesExecuted()
public final void setFlushesExecuted(long val)
public final void clearFlushesExecuted()
public final boolean hasName()
public final XString getName()
public final void getNameTo(XString val)
public final void setNameFrom(String val)
public final void setNameFrom(CharSequence val)
public final void setNameFrom(long val)
public final void setNameFrom(byte[] val,
int offset,
int len)
public final void setNameFrom(XString val)
public final void setNameFrom(XStringDeserializer val)
public final void clearName()
public final void clear()
public final void setAsReadOnly()
public final boolean isInitialized()
public final void setInitialized()
public final void clearDirty()
public final void forceDirty()
public final boolean isDirty()
public final int getSerializedLength()
public final int serialize(SrvMonAdminClientStats.Serializer serializer)
public final void deserialize(SrvMonAdminClientStats.Deserializer deserializer)
public final SrvMonAdminClientStats.Pojo reset()
public final SrvMonAdminClientStats.Pojo init()
UtlPool.ItemThis method is invoked by an item pool very time an item is put into the pool. The method should wipe the contents of the item so as to present a fresh instance of the item to the caller when retrieved from the pool.
init in interface UtlPool.Item<SrvMonAdminClientStats.Pojo>public final SrvMonAdminClientStats.Pojo setPool(UtlPool<SrvMonAdminClientStats.Pojo> pool)
UtlPool.ItemThis method is invoked by an item pool at the time an item is added to the pool. The intent is to record the item's source pool in the item so it can be disposed back into the pool when the user is done working with it.
setPool in interface UtlPool.Item<SrvMonAdminClientStats.Pojo>public final UtlPool<SrvMonAdminClientStats.Pojo> getPool()
UtlPool.Item
This method should return the pool set using UtlPool.Item.setPool(com.neeve.util.UtlPool<T>)
getPool in interface UtlPool.Item<SrvMonAdminClientStats.Pojo>UtlPool.Item.setPool(com.neeve.util.UtlPool<T>)Copyright © 2019 N5 Technologies, Inc. All Rights Reserved.